Dr. David Mcmanus practices Emergency Medicine in Lafayette, LA. Dr. Mcmanus assesses patients who seek immediate medical attention at any time of day or night. Emergency Medicine Physicians are trained to efficiently work with each patient and situation no matter how acute or life-threatening. Dr. Mcmanus examines patients, determines means of testing, diagnoses conditions, and decides the best treatment methods.
Education and Training
Louisiana State University Health Shreveport / School of Medicine 1987
Board Certification
Emergency MedicineAmerican Board of Emergency MedicineABEM
